- Add builtin manpage via --man (the same way as I did the --man support
for "bldenv"). The seperate webrev.1 file in the sources will be removed
in the next webrev and instead the build will use $ webrev --nroff # on
the script to get the *roff source for the manpage (this should lower
maintaince since "getopts" string and manpage are now one string/blob).
I am not sure I follow. The webrev for this change (what is the CR
number, by the way ?) dispays just webrev.sh. It looks like the removal
of webrev.1 is missing in the changeset.
Also, I have 3 concerns regarding this particular change:
- it seems it's time to stop the explosion of the script in terms of
space; it's way too long already.
- is the generated man page really the same as the old one ? Maybe
you could produce a diff of the original man page and the man page
generated from the 'USAGE' field ?
- not sure if sucking the man page into the script is the right thing
to do (say the script will be rewritten into Python one day). Why is
that necessary ?
